titleOfInvention | Use the method that undesirable plant prevented and treated in Herbicid resistant crop by imidazolinone herbicide and auxiliary agent |
abstract | A kind of Herbicidal combinations, it comprises: a) be selected from the herbicidal compounds A of imidazolone type;And b) auxiliary agent B, it is the surfactant selected from group b1 b5: b1) formula R 1 X n Nonionic surfactant and poly-alkoxylation derivant, wherein R 1 Selected from aliphatic series or the aromatic group with at least 8 carbon atoms;X is selected from hydroxyl, O (C 1 ‑C 6 Alkyl), O (C 3 ‑C 6 Alkenyl), amine, amide or ester;And n is 1,2,3,4,5 or 6;B2) formula R 1 Y n Anion surfactant, wherein R 1 Selected from aliphatic series or the aromatic group with at least 8 carbon atoms;Y is selected from carboxylate radical, sulfonate radical, sulfate radical, phosphate radical or phosphonate radical;And n is 1,2,3,4,5 or 6;B3) cationic surfactant;B4) zwitterionic surfactant;Or b5) polymeric surfactant;Wherein herbicidal compounds A is 2:1 1:60 with the weight ratio of auxiliary agent B;And the purposes that described compositions is in preventing and treating undesirable plant. |
